This officer was Odessa's comrade who served alongside him as Romanian military officers. They boarded the train, VMC 64 together heading for an unknown destination.
History[]
The officer and Odessa first encountered Josh when he stumbled across their cabin, the officer shrugged him off while Odessa continued to read his newspapers. Upon hearing the commotion across the cart, the two went to investigate, only to come face to face with the masked juggernaut, Ernst. The two tried to subdue him with their pistols, only for Ernst to retaliate by stabbing the officer with his harpoon and then dismembering him.
"I'm not a coward. What happened in Chechnya was not my fault. My gun jammed. It really did... I couldn't have saved them anyway."
The officer's background was further explored in the nightmare realm in Act 7, revealing that the officer wasn't able to save some people in Chechnya. Convincing himself that they died not because he was a coward, but rather his gun jammed and that he wouldn't have been able to saved them anyway.
